Factors to Consider When Choosing a Wi-Fi Extender for VR

vr wi fi extender considerations

When choosing a Wi-Fi extender for VR, I focus on signal strength and range to guarantee smooth gameplay without lag. I also consider bandwidth capacity to support high-quality streams and check device compatibility for seamless integration. Finally, I look for easy setup and strong security features to keep my network safe and hassle-free.

Signal Strength and Range

A strong Wi-Fi signal is essential for a seamless VR experience, as weak coverage can lead to lag, buffering, and disconnections that ruin immersion. When choosing an extender, look for one with a high maximum coverage, like 13,355 sq.ft., to guarantee it reaches every corner of your space. External antennas and beamforming technology are game-changers—they boost signal strength and stability, especially through walls and floors. The range should be enough to cover your entire VR play area without dead zones, maintaining consistent performance. Dual-band support (2.4GHz and 5GHz) helps optimize coverage and reduce interference, giving you a smoother, more reliable connection. Prioritizing signal strength and range ensures your VR setup remains responsive and immersive.

Bandwidth Capacity Needed

Choosing the right Wi-Fi extender for VR hinges on its bandwidth capacity, as high data rates are essential for smooth, high-quality streaming. For a single-user setup, I recommend an extender supporting at least 1200 Mbps to ensure seamless HD VR content without buffering. When multiple users are gaming simultaneously, I look for options with a minimum of 1800 Mbps to prevent lag and latency. Dual-band extenders offering separate 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z channels help optimize bandwidth distribution, which is crucial for stable connections. Additionally, advanced technologies like WiFi 6 or WiFi 7 greatly enhance throughput and bandwidth management, making them ideal for demanding VR applications. Prioritizing high bandwidth capacity guarantees real-time responsiveness, a must for immersive wireless VR experiences.

Compatibility With Devices

To guarantee your VR experience runs smoothly, it’s crucial to select a Wi-Fi extender that’s compatible with your devices. First, ensure it supports dual-band frequencies (2.4GHz and 5GHz), as VR devices need high-speed, low-latency connections. Check that the extender matches the Wi-Fi standards your devices use—whether Wi-Fi 5 or Wi-Fi 6—for peak performance. It’s also important that the extender can handle multiple device connections simultaneously, since VR setups often include peripherals and streaming gadgets. Additionally, verify it supports WPA3 or WPA2 security protocols to keep your gaming safe. If you use wired connections, look for extenders with enough Ethernet ports to connect your VR equipment directly, reducing latency and improving stability. Compatibility is key to a seamless VR experience.

Setup Simplicity Level

Since setting up a Wi-Fi extender can sometimes feel intimidating, prioritizing models with simple installation features makes the process much easier. One-touch setup options like WPS allow for quick, hassle-free installation without needing technical skills. Extenders that support app-based configuration provide step-by-step guidance, making setup straightforward and user-friendly. Clear, intuitive indicator lights help me position the device correctly and confirm a successful connection with minimal effort. Additionally, choosing an extender with multiple modes—such as Repeater, Access Point, or Ethernet—can adapt easily to different home network setups, simplifying integration. Compatibility with my existing router and support for standard setup methods further reduce complexity, ensuring I can get my VR gaming network up and running swiftly and smoothly.

Security Protocol Features

Ensuring your Wi-Fi extender has robust security features is vital when setting up a reliable VR gaming network. I look for devices that support WPA3, offering advanced encryption and better protection against cyber threats. If WPA3 isn’t available, I make certain the extender supports WPA or WPA2 encryption to keep my network safe. Real-time risk detection and threat prevention features are also essential—they help identify and block potential security breaches proactively. I double-check that the extender’s security protocols are compatible with my existing router to avoid gaps in protection. Regular firmware updates are a must, as they fix vulnerabilities and improve security over time. Prioritizing these features helps maintain a secure, fast, and seamless VR gaming experience.

Multiple Device Support

When choosing a Wi-Fi extender for VR, supporting multiple devices simultaneously is essential to prevent lag and disconnections. I look for extenders that support at least 50 to 80 devices, ensuring my VR headsets, controllers, and other smart gadgets stay connected without issues. Multi-user MIMO (MU-MIMO) technology is a must, as it allows the extender to handle multiple connections efficiently without sacrificing performance. For larger setups, I prefer models supporting over 100 devices to avoid network congestion during intense gaming sessions. Bandwidth capabilities are also critical—dual-band or tri-band extenders help maintain stable, fast connections across all devices. Ultimately, strong signal strength and extensive coverage are crucial, especially in multi-room or large VR environments, to keep everything running smoothly.

Ease of Placement

Choosing the right placement for your Wi-Fi extender can make a significant difference in your VR experience. Look for models with adjustable or omnidirectional antennas, which make it easier to direct signals where you need them most. A signal strength indicator or LED lights are incredibly helpful—they guide you to the best spot without guesswork. Opt for a compact, lightweight device that fits into various outlet types without blocking other sockets. Simpler setups, like one-touch WPS, save time and frustration during placement. Position your extender centrally between your router and VR area to maximize coverage and minimize dead zones. By considering these factors, you’ll ensure your Wi-Fi extender is easy to position for the best possible VR gaming exper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Do Wi-Fi Extenders Specifically Improve VR Gaming Latency?

Wi-Fi extenders improve VR gaming latency by boosting your signal strength and reducing lag. When I use one, it creates a stronger, more stable connection between my headset and the router, which minimizes delays in data transmission. This means my VR experience is smoother, with less buffering or lag spikes. Fundamentally, they help deliver a more responsive and immersive gaming experience by ensuring my wireless connection stays fast and reliable.

Can Wi-Fi Extenders Support Multiple VR Headsets Simultaneously?

Yes, Wi-Fi extenders can support multiple VR headsets at once, but it depends on their capacity and network setup. I recommend using a high-performance extender with strong bandwidth and multiple streams to make certain of smooth gameplay for everyone. Keep in mind, network congestion can impact performance, so it’s best to optimize your setup and choose extenders that handle multiple devices efficiently for the best experience.

What Are the Best Placement Tips for Vr-Specific Wi-Fi Extenders?

I recommend placing your VR-specific Wi-Fi extender halfway between your router and VR headset, ideally in a central, open spot. Keep it elevated, like on a shelf or wall mount, to avoid obstructions. Avoid placing it near metal objects or electronics that can cause interference. Regularly check signal strength and adjust placement if you notice lag or disconnects, ensuring a smooth VR experience.

Do Wi-Fi Extenders Cause Any Input Lag or Signal Delay?

Wi-Fi extenders can sometimes cause slight input lag or signal delay, but it’s usually minimal if you choose a high-quality one. I’ve seen it happen in rare cases, and it’s like a tiny ripple in an otherwise perfect mirror. To minimize this, I recommend placing the extender ideally and using dual-band models. Overall, with the right setup, your VR experience stays smooth and immersive without noticeable lag.

Are There Compatibility Issues Between Wi-Fi Extenders and Different VR Devices?

Yes, there can be compatibility issues between Wi-Fi extenders and different VR devices, especially if the extender isn’t compatible with your router’s frequency or Wi-Fi standards. I recommend checking the extender’s specifications to make sure it supports your VR headset’s requirements. Sometimes, firmware updates are needed, so keep everything up to date. Proper setup and choosing a compatible extender help minimize lag and ensure a smooth VR experience.
